A good boarding provider will want to know your cat's quirks—like if they get a little anxious during our classic Ohio thunderstorms that roll across the farmland.
Practical tips for Waldo folks? Start your search early, especially around peak travel times like the holidays or during the Marion County Fair. Visit the facility if you can, or have a thorough meet-and-greet with a sitter. Bring a piece of home—a familiar blanket or a favorite toy from our local Waldo General Store can provide immense comfort. Most importantly, provide clear instructions and your vet's contact info (shout-out to our nearby veterinary clinics!).
